That kind of detail is what separates a credible claim from one that gets dismissed or lowballed.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Driver Logs and Hours of Service Records Federal regulations limit how many hours a commercial truck driver can operate without rest. These rules exist because fatigued driving is a serious and well-documented cause of crashes. Paper logs can be falsified, but electronic logging devices (ELDs) — now required on most commercial trucks — create a record that&#039;s harder to manipulate. Discrepancies between paper logs and ELD data have helped prove driver fatigue in cases where the official story was something else entirely.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;You must report your injury to your employer in writing within 30 days of when it happened.
